The Importance of Cooker Extractors
Cooker extractors serve several vital functions in a kitchen:
Ventilation: They enhance air quality by getting rid of cooking fumes and excess moisture.Odor Control: By filtering and expelling smoke and odors, they can keep the kitchen pleasant for cooking and amusing.Allergen Reduction: Cooker extractors can help to lessen irritants and irritants in the air, such as smoke particles and grease.Energy Efficiency: Improved ventilation can improve the effectiveness of cooking devices, gaining [Best Cooker Hoods](https://git.auwiesen2.de/extractor-fan-kitchen3831) cooking conditions with less energy use.Types of Cooker Extractors
When picking a cooker extractor, homeowners can select from numerous types, each with its unique functions and advantages:
TypeDescriptionProsConsWall-MountedSet up straight on the wall above the stove.Stylish design; space-savingNeeds wall space; may not match all kitchen layouts.Under-CabinetRepaired under kitchen cabinets, drawing air through a vent that leads outside or recirculates it.Compact; blends with kitchen cabinetryRestricted extraction power; may need additional clearance.IslandSuspended over a kitchen island, often designed to be a main feature in open-plan areas.Aesthetic appeal; effective extractionGreater installation costs; may not fit all decor designs.DowndraftRetracts into the countertop when not in use and rises when triggered.Space-efficient; modern designLess powerful; requirements dependable counter area.Ceiling-MountedInstalled directly into the ceiling, ideal for open kitchens without any walls for standard hoods.Effective for big areasPossibly intricate setup; may require structural support.Factors to Consider When Choosing a Cooker Extractor
When it concerns selecting the perfect cooker extractor, here are some factors that will assist guide the choice:
Size: Ensure the extractor matches the size of your stove. Generally, it needs to be at least as wide as the cooking surface.Extraction Power: Measured in cubic feet per minute (CFM), the power determines the quantity of air the hood can move, impacting its effectiveness. Consider a higher CFM for heavy cooking designs.Ducted vs. Ductless: Ducted extractors vent air outside, while ductless designs filter air and recirculate it back into the kitchen. Ducted choices are normally more effective and reliable.Noise Level: Consider the decibel (dB) rating of the extractor. A quieter model can make cooking more pleasant.Additional Features: Features such as lighting, speed settings, and built-in filters can enhance functionality and functionality.Setup Considerations
Proper setup of a cooker extractor guarantees ideal efficiency and longevity. Here are important setup factors to consider:
Height Above Cooktop: Partially determined by the kind of cooker extractor, the suggested height is typically in between 24 to 30 inches above the cooktop for wall-mounted or under-cabinet designs.Duct Work: For ducted designs, think about the range and bends of ducting; straight runs minimize noise and optimize effectiveness.Electrical Connections: Ensure compatibility with existing circuitry; some models might require professional setup.Ventilation Paths: Identify the best course for air to leave or re-enter, enhancing energy use and air quality.Upkeep Tips
Routine upkeep keeps cooker extractors operating successfully. Here are some vital ideas:
Clean Filters: Depending on usage, filters must be washed or changed every 1-3 months. Aluminum filters can be cleaned with soap and water, while charcoal filters require replacement.Clean Down Surfaces: Regularly clean the exterior surfaces to remove grease and dust accumulation.Look for Blockages: Regularly check vents and ducts for obstructions to make sure optimal airflow.Update Light Bulbs: If the extractor has built-in lights, check them periodically to preserve visibility while cooking.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1. How do I understand what size cooker extractor to pick?
The size is usually identified by the width of your cooking surface area. Many specialists advise a cooker extractor that is at least as wide as the [Stove Extractor Fan](https://veganeur.com/author/kitchen-cooker-hoods9703/) for optimal performance.
2. Should I select a ducted or ductless cooker extractor?
Ducted cooker extractors are usually more powerful and efficient, as they vent air exterior. If outside venting isn't an alternative, a ductless model may appropriate, however bear in mind it may not be as efficient in eliminating smells and grease.
3. How often should I change the filters in my cooker extractor?
It depends upon usage. Grease filters must generally be cleaned every 1 to 3 months. Charcoal filters should be replaced per the maker's recommendations, typically every 6-12 months.
4. Can I install a cooker extractor myself?
While some may choose to do it themselves, it's typically recommended to employ a professional, specifically for ducted installations that need electrical and structural changes.
5. What is the ideal sound level for a cooker extractor?
A sound level of 50 dB or less is typically considered acceptable; the lower the number, the quieter the extraction will be. Think about sound levels if you often utilize your kitchen for gatherings.
